Cooking the Bacon
Heat a skillet over medium heat.
Cook the beef bacon until crispy, turning occasionally.
Transfer the bacon to a paper towel-lined plate to drain excess grease.
Assembling the Sandwich
Spread mayonnaise evenly on one side of each bread slice.
Layer one slice with lettuce, tomato slices, and crispy bacon.
Sprinkle a pinch of salt and pepper over the tomatoes for enhanced flavor.
Final Touches
Place the second slice of bread on top, mayonnaise side down.
Cut the sandwich in half and serve immediately.
- Storage: Wrap leftover sandwiches tightly in plastic wrap and refrigerate for up to 1 day. For best results, assemble just before eating.
- Reheating: To keep the bread crispy, reheat the sandwich in a toaster oven at 180°C (350°F) for 5 minutes. Avoid microwaving to prevent sogginess.
- Variations: Add avocado slices or a fried egg for extra flavor and nutrition. Swap mayonnaise with Greek yogurt for a lighter option.
